January 27, 201510 yr I see only a four functions switch box. Since this is not an RC model, there is not a big point about steering... So I see: mast raising/lowering, grabber up/down, superstructure rotation, fwd/rev. Such cranes are also very slow. Hence the reducing gear ratio in the front. Being very slow, steering also turns to be a bit less important.
